SmartLivingNEXT: COMET – First data donations successfully launched

The SmartLivingNEXT project COMET puts users at the center. It enables them to retain control of their data at all times and makes it available to companies for AI-based innovations. This requires voluntary data donations. The first successful donations have now been made.

COMET gives users more control over their data and enables companies to access high-quality data for AI-based innovations. With data donations, citizens provide their data voluntarily and in an informed manner. The first data donations have now been collected via an app. More than 90% of the calls are from users who release their data for anonymized storage for research at Goethe University Frankfurt – this corresponds to around 8,000 calls per day.

Sharing their data also has benefits for the donors: The EHW+ app, which was developed by a start-up, helps users to better monitor their electricity, gas, water and heating consumption, estimate future costs and identify potential savings. All meter readings are recorded by the user, making the app accessible to everyone – regardless of expensive sensors or automated devices. Users can also synchronize their consumption across different devices and share it with roommates, while their data remains protected at all times. Regardless of their permanent data sharing, they receive statistics on their consumption forecast and donate their data in large numbers to help improve the prediction algorithm in the future.

These first data donations show that users are willing to share their data if they also receive added value through services such as better predictions. In turn, the data collected is of great importance for improving prediction algorithms. In the long term, other partners in the SmartLivingNEXT ecosystem should also be able to make such requests and benefit from data donations accordingly.
